I get so many questions on various topics related to behavioral and social emotional learning in classrooms. In this episode I answer some of my most frequently asked questions about the essential elements to your classroom management plan as well as tips for collecting data as a special education teacher, and how to teach kids to use a break appropriately! In this episode you will learnMy top two areas of focus for your classroom management planMy strategies for taking data efficiently in your classroom for your IEP and BIP goals How to teach students to take a break appropriately My tips for new teachers entering in a classroom with a behavioral focusMy book recommendations for learning about behavioral strategies for your classroomVisit my website for more behavioral and social emotional resources for your students.Follow me on Instagram for daily content and tips as well!PS. The Teaching Behavior Together Podcast provides teachers with strategies to increase their classroom management while incorporating behavioral and social emotional learning strategies in their classrooms. Gone are the days of frustration and tearful rides home. Each episode will provide teachers with actionable steps to creating a classroom they look forward to going to each morning! Your host, Maria, has 10 years experience helping teachers set up successful classroom management plans that increase student success. She has a PhD in special education and applied behavior analysis and has her dream job supporting teachers with classroom management and incorporating behavioral and social emotional learning in their classrooms.
